Eagle Flies In Dream Time


On Monday, I was walking in Fish Creek Park with my friends when we saw this huge eagle sitting in a tree by the Bow River.  It made me remember a dream.

I believe that the Eagle is the Guardian Teacher of the East.  I believe that Eagle flies where it needs to fly.  I believe that Eagle flies in my dreams to teach me.  

One of these dreams that I remember began with Eagle sitting in a tree in a deserted farm yard across the road from the farm that I grew up on.  Eagle began to chase the birds out of the tree.  Then, its mate joined it, and they both swooped about the tree, scaring the birds.  Suddenly, one Eagle flew off and landed in our field that was south of the farm yard.  The other Eagle looked at me, and then flew to the ground.  It began to walk.  As it walked, it grew bigger until it was so large that it could step over the fence, into our field.  

I was so excited.  I pulled out my camera. I ran to the fence and crawled through it to take pictures of these huge Eagles.  As I was getting focused, a herd of white and pale brown and palomino horses came galloping up.  My two large Eagles faced the herd and morphed into two very large white horses.  Two of the smaller white horses trotted up to them and I realized that the small horses were the Eagle’s offspring.  I grew even more excited and thought “no one will believe this”.  Just as I started to snap pictures, I woke up!

I was so upset that I didn’t have a camera, that I was not out on the field, and that my Eagles had disappeared.

Gorilla on Growing Children In My Meditation

 image

Gorilla walked into my meditation space and sat down.  She flashed me a picture of her two offspring, and said, “I want to talk.”

She continued on.  “When raising children, one needs to remember that we parents are preparing them for life.  We need to teach them kindness, independence, and how to think things through.  We need to teach them how to feed themselves, fend for themselves, and how to fend for others if required.  It is a sacred job that the One Spirit has given us.  We must do it well.”

And then she got up and walked away.

50 Golden Rules For Life

Picture of mountains in Elbow Falls Wilderness Area - by J. Hirst

Often, I find that I need a pick-me-up mental or spiritual boost on some morning.  I read a lot and sometimes find nuggets of good information in places I do not expect to find anything useful.

Last month, I was scanning LinkedIn and found this wonderful posting by Alvin Foo on LinkedIn on February 24 2024.  His thoughts and his rules for life are worth sharing.

50 GOLDEN RULES FOR LIFE.

1. Never shake hands at anyone without standing up.

2. In a negotiation, never make the first offer.

3. If they trust you a secret, keep it.

4. If they lend you a car, return it with a full tank.

5. Do things with passion or don't do it at all.

6. When you shake your hand make it firm and look that person in the eye.

7. Live the experience of traveling alone.

8. Never turn down a peppermint pill, the reasons are obvious.

9. Take advice if you want to grow old.

10. Come eat with the new person at school/office.

11. When you text someone and you're angry: finish, read it, delete it, and rewrite the message.

12. At the table you don't talk about work, politics, or religion.

13. Write your goals, and work on them.

14. Defend your point of view but be tolerant and respectful to others.

15. Call and visit your relatives.

16. Never regret anything, learn from everything

17. Honor and loyalty must be present in your personality.

18. Don't lend money to someone you know won't pay you back.

19. Believe in something.

20. Tend your bed when you wake up in the mornings.

21. Sing in the shower.

22. Care for a plant or a garden.

23. Keep an eye on the sky every chance you get.

24. Discover your skills and exploit them.

25. Love your job or leave it.

26. Ask for help when you need it.

27. Teach someone a value, preferably a small one.

28. Appreciate and thank the one who extends your hand.

29. Be kind to your neighbors.

30. Make someone's day happier, it will make you happier too.

31. Compete with yourself.

32 Treat yourself at least once a year

33. Take care of your health.

34. Always greet with a smile.

35. Think fast but speak slow.

36. Don't talk with a mouth full.

37. Polish your shoes, cut your nails, and always keep a good look.

38. Don't put your opinion on issues you don't know.

39. Never mistreat anyone.

40. Live your life as if it were the last day of it.

41. Never miss a wonderful opportunity to remain quiet.

42. Recognize someone for their effort.

43. Be humble, even though not all the time.

44. Never forget your roots.

45. Travel when you can.

46. Give up the step.

47 Dance in the rain.

48. Seek your success without giving up.

49. Be fair, stand up for those who need you.

50. Learn to enjoy moments of loneliness.
